A Minimal Book Tracker Printable for Your Reading Journal

This book tracker printable PDF includes one simple page with a clean 3ร—3 layout, giving you space for 9 book icons on one sheet.

Compared to larger reading trackers, this version feels more spacious and intentional. Itโ€™s ideal if you prefer a cleaner layout or want to highlight favorite reads rather than tracking dozens of books at once.

Under every book, there are 5 stars that you can color in after finishing a book as your personal rating system.

You can customize each mini book in different ways:

  • Write the book title inside the book shape
  • Print mini book covers and paste them inside
  • Use the stars to rate each read
  • Create a visual bookshelf of books youโ€™ve completed
  • Build a personalized reading memory page

It feels simple, but thatโ€™s exactly what makes it enjoyable.

There are 2 versions available:

Blank Version

Perfect for planners, binders, or clean journaling pages.

Dot-grid Version

Ideal for bullet journal lovers who want to blend it naturally into their spreads.

How to Download and Use This Book Tracker

Getting started is easy.

1. Download the printable

Save the PDF to your device. The download link is at the end of this post.

2. Choose how you want to use it

Print it or upload it into your favorite digital planning app.

3. Add your books

Write titles directly into each book or attach mini printed covers.

4. Rate each book

Color in the five stars below each book after you finish reading.

5. Repeat whenever needed

Because it has a smaller layout, you can use multiple pages for different reading goals, favorite books, or yearly categories.
